A GNU GRUB 1

Közvetlenül azután, hogy a számítógép BIOS a rendszerindító eszköz, elolvassa a memóriában az első szektorban, és átadja a vezérlést. Ez az ágazat általában az úgynevezett MBR (Master Boot Record), mérete 512 byte. Amellett, hogy a boot loader, van még és a partíciós tábla lemez mérete 64 bájt, ezért közvetlenül a rakodó továbbra is nagyon kis helyet foglal. A Windows boot loader küld egy újabb ellenőrzés Boot Record a primer szakasz, amelyben a védjegy „indítható”.

Néhány évvel ezelőtt voltam LILO (Linux Loader) Linuxot indítani. Ő legnagyobb hátránya az, hogy újra kell-frissítés minden alkalommal fájlallokációját térképet. Jelenleg a legtöbb disztribúció GRUB (Grand Unified Bootloader).

Hogy a GRUB

A GRUB primer szekunder rendszerindító okoz nem közvetlenül, hanem egy úgynevezett BONDER szakaszban (Stage 1,5), és amely átadja a vezérlést a másodlagos boot betöltő. Az eredmény nem csak a támogatás sokféle fájlrendszerek, hanem megváltoztatni a boot opciók csak be kell szerkeszteni a konfigurációs fájl, amely az úgynevezett /boot/grub/menu.lst.

Szintén initrd (initial RAM disk) lehet használni rakodási, akkor betöltődik a memóriába, olyan alapvető, amelynek szövege szükséges megfelelő beindításához modulok, majd betölti a kernel közvetlenül.

Nyissa meg a /boot/grub/menu.lst fájlt

Ez azt jelzi, hogy melyik elem lesz betöltve alapesetben, a számozást nullával kezdődik. Ez azt jelenti, ebben az esetben először menüpont van kiválasztva.

Idő, amely után automatikusan betölti az alapértelmezett beállítás.

cián / kék fehér / kék

A szín a kiválasztott és nem kiválasztott menüpontok. A listát a megfelelő színeket és neve megtalálható /usr/share/X11/rgb.txt fájlt.

Arra is lehetőség van, hogy egy grafikus háttér a rendszer menüben. Ezt használja a következő paramétereket:

Itt (hd0,0) - egy rész, ahol a / boot partíció

Arra is szükség van, hogy konvertálja a képet olyan formában, hogy a GRUB megérti (XPM, 14 színben, 640x480), és bepakolni. Ez úgy történik, az alábbiak szerint:

$ Convert myimage.png színű 14 -resize 640x480 myimage.xpm | gzip

és másolja a mappát a GRUB

# Cp myimage.xpm.gz / boot / grub /

By the way, érdemes megjegyezni, hogy a GRUB kissé szokatlan partíció számozási rendszert. Ahelyett, hogy a szokásos / dev / hdaX (hdbX, hdcX (sdax, sdbX SCSI és SATA meghajtók), stb ...), ahol x - a partíció száma, 1-től kezdődően, használja a saját rendszerén. Ez vezet a következő módon jellemezhetők: (HDA, B), ahol A - a lemez számát, kezdve 0, és B - a szakasz számát, továbbá a semmiből. Ez azt jelenti, a / dev / sda1 lesz a továbbiakban (hd0,0), és a Windows lenne a C:.

Most nézd meg a menüpontok közvetlenül.

cím Debian GNU / Linux kernel 2.6.26-1-686-bigmem
gyökér (hd0,5)
kernel /vmlinuz-2.6.26-1-686-bigmem root = / dev / sda7 ro noapic vga = 792
initrd /initrd.img-2.6.26-1-686-bigmem

cím - amely megjelenik közvetlenül a menüből

gyökér - partíció / formázza a GRUB

kernel - melyik fájl a mag és milyen paramétereket kell átadni neki induláskor

initrd - ami fájlt használja az initrd

Ha Windows, akkor a rekord az alábbiak szerint:

cím Microsoft Windows
root (hd0,0)
savedefault
makeactive
chainloader 1

savedefault - azt jelzi, hogy szükség van, hogy memorizálni a kiválasztott elemet, ha az opció meg van adva

makeactive - mert a Windows csak elindulni az aktív partíció, ez az opció teszi a partíció aktív

chainloader 1 - át kell tenni azonnal betölteni ezt a részt. Egy ilyen módszer az úgynevezett terhelés-lánca (loading)

Lehetőség van arra is, hogy módosítsa a virtuális merevlemezek néhány helyen. Például, ha van telepített Windows a második lemezen, és így nem tud elindulni, akkor az elemet le a következőket:

térkép (hd0) (hd1)
térkép (hd1) (hd0)

Szerkesztési lehetőségek bootoláskor

Még nem az operációs rendszer indítása, akkor szerkesztheti azt kell betölteni.

Kezdetben megjeleníti az operációs rendszerek közül lehet választani. Válasszon ki egyet, kattintson a Tovább gombra E szerkeszthetjük a menüt. Ennek eredményeképpen megkapjuk a menü a kiválasztott elem. Tegyünk mire van szükségünk, például a paramétert a mag vga = 792, amely meghatározza a szöveges módban 1024x768-as felbontás 24 bites szín. Ezután, hogy mi nyomja meg az Entert és B tölteni ezt a tartalmat. Ha szükségünk van valamire, hogy megszünteti, vagy emelkedik egy magasabb szintre, akkor nyomja meg az Esc billentyűt.

Visszaállítása után a GRUB MBR volt zatorta

Tegyük fel, a Linux telepítése után, azt akarjuk, hogy a Windows, amely nem tudja az alternatív betöltőtől. És persze, hogy felülírja az MBR. Most vissza kell állítani vissza. A probléma megoldására számos módja van.

Indíts a live-cd linux vagy telepítőlemez tartalmaz, akkor a helyreállítási módba. Például a Debian GNU / Linux letöltése előtt bevezetni mentési és válassza futtatni a shell részben hol vagyunk a gyökér. Ezután rögzítse a / boot partíció, és a / usr, ha egy másik partícióra.

# Mount / dev / sda8 / usr
# Mount / dev / sda6 / boot

Most telepítse újra a GRUB

Ha szeretné indítani a live-cd, akkor a root (például / dev / sda7) egy mappában (amit előre kell létrehozni).

# Mount / deb / sda7 / media / disk
# Mount / dev / sda8 / media / disk / usr
# Mount / dev / sda6 / media / disk / boot

És újra az GRUB

# Grub-install --root-directory = / media / disk / dev / sda

Is, akkor telepítse újra a GRUB segítségével a héj. Ha van egy / boot ugyanazon a partíción, mint a gyökér a boot a live cd is járjon el.

# grub
> Find / boot / grub / stage1 - megadja a partíciót, amelyre a rakodó, például: hd0,2
> Root (hd0,2)
> Beállítás (hd0)

By the way, a héj egy meglehetősen erős jellegét. A rendelkezésre álló parancsok megtalálhatók a futás segít.

Hogyan távolítsuk el a Linux

Természetesen remélem, hogy nem kell igénybe, de néha ez az információ hasznos lehet. Csak meg kell emlékezni, hogy nem szükséges eltávolítani az összes partíciót, hogy használta a Linux, mert az MBR tönkölybúza letöltő azt egyikük. Ahhoz, hogy megfelelően cserélni, telepíteni kell a Windows helyreállítási konzolt (mi ez, és mit kell - nem az anyagi ebben a cikkben), és töltse le. Ott meg kell adnia a következő:

fixmbr
nyomja meg ay
fixboot
nyomja meg ay
kijárat

Természetesen ez még nem minden, hogy képes GRUB, például lehet tenni annak érdekében, hogy a menü nem jelenik meg, vagy a szerkesztési volt jelszóval védett. További információk a következő címen szerezhetők bejelentkezik a hivatalos honlapján www.gnu.org/software/grub és olvassa el az útmutatót és GYIK. Általában a Linux rendelkezik, hogy tanulmányozza a dokumentumokat. Amíg a következő alkalommal.

Kapcsolódó cikkek